Project Description
Arley Sewage Treatment Works (STW) is a medium sized trickling filter works. In AMP7, under the Water Framework Directive (WFD), the site has to meet a new total phosphorus (TP) consent of 0.3 mg/l, and an Iron consent of 4 mg/l. To achieve these new consent standards, Severn Trent installed a FilterClear® plant.
The decision was based on a comprehensive whole life cost (WLC) assessment of various tertiary solids removal (TSR) plants. The FilterClear® skid was assembled and hydraulically tested off-site at Bluewater’s works,
before being transported to site for installation on
a flat concrete slab.
The site was commissioned with Ferric dosing
for P removal, and the FilterClear performance demonstrated that the compliance can be
achieved reliably.

Arley STW Process Parameters
| Average flow | 17 l/s |
| Maximum flow | 120 l/s |
| Design Influent TSS conc. (incl. chemical solids) | 38 mg/L (average) 70 mg/L (98%ile) |
| Effluent TP consent | 0.3 mg/L (average) |
| Effluent Fe consent | 4 mg/L (95%ile) |
